Ingredients
-
2 pounds ground beef
-
1 (7 ounce) can minced chipotle peppers in adobo sauce, or to taste
-
1 bunch green onions, minced
-
¼ cup bread crumbs
-
1 ½ teaspoons garlic powder, or to taste
-
1 ½ teaspoons salt, or to taste
-
1 ½ teaspoons ground black pepper, or to taste
-
1 (16 ounce) package spaghetti
-
1 (15 ounce) can spaghetti sauce
-
¼ cup grated Parmesan cheese
Directions
-
Preheat o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C). Grease a baking sheet.
-
Mix the ground beef, chipotle peppers with the adobo sauce, green onions, bread crumbs, garlic powder, salt, and pepper together in a bowl until evenly mixed. Roll the mixture into balls the size of cherry tomatoes. Arrange on the prepared baking sheet.
-
Bake in the preheated oven until cooked through, about 30 minutes.
-
While the meatballs bake, bring a large pot of lightly-salted water to a boil. Add the spaghetti and return to a boil. Cook until tender but still firm to the bite, about 12 minutes. Drain.
-
Pour the spaghetti sauce in a large saucepan over medium heat; cook until hot, 5 to 7 minutes. Add the cooked meatballs and stir to coat. Ladle over the drained spaghetti and top with the grated Parmesan cheese to serve.
